Success rarely originates from sweeping overhauls; it originates from thoroughly sequencing improvements so that each step builds stability without disrupting daily operations. By pacing the transformation, companies can understand measurable gains while preserving connection. Proven playbooks: Developed structures for scaling company procedures provide more than a beginning point; they provide a structure formed by repeating, improvement, and quantifiable results.
Phased rollouts: Parallel runs and incremental shifts permit teams to adopt new systems while existing operations remain completely functional. This deliberate pacing reduces direct exposure to run the risk of, produces area for real-time adjustments, and helps workers acquire self-confidence in the new structure before it totally changes the old. Change management: Process improvement for development is successful just when individuals are aligned with the improvement.

In this context, exploring ingenious service growth ideas can further sustain the effect of growth hacking techniques, introducing fresh point of views and strategies to enhance your service's growth efforts How 2026 Tariffs Are Improving Small Company How to Develop a Company Automation Technique That In Fact Scales Company Advancement Growth Method: Sustainable Success Methods An organization scaling method is a strategy developed to support and handle the growth of a business in a sustainable and efficient manner.
This strategic technique concentrates on enhancing internal processes, leveraging technology, boosting consumer experiences, and possibly going into new markets or sections. The objective is to increase revenue and market penetration while preserving operational effectiveness and profitability as the company grows.
